PRP Therapy

PRP therapy is a skincare and hair loss treatment that uses platelet-rich plasma concentrate to enrich a portion of the blood to facilitate tissue growth. Along with platelets, it is also enriched with a range of growth factors that stimulates hair growth, minimizes scar tissue and also skin rejuvenation.

PRP Therapy is Recommended to Treat

  • Hair Loss - Stimulates new hair growth
  • Skin rejuvenation - Increases dermal collagen and elastic fibres
  • Scar treatment - Improve scar appearance by collagen production
  • Ulcer/ wound management - Accelerate wound healing through supplementary growth factors
  • Stretch marks - Cover up scars through supportive collagen production
The Procedure of PRP Therapy

The procedure involves collecting about 16-20 ml of your blood under sterile conditions. The blood is then processed and in about 40 mins PRP is ready to be injected back into your body through a fine injection or after microneedling/laser resurfacing. A topical anesthesia/vibrating device is used to alleviate the pain during the procedure.

For every type of treatment, one can start to notice a difference as early as after 2 sessions. But a total of 6 sessions are required to achieve complete results. A maintenance session may be required every 4-6 months once.

Hair loss: About 6 sessions every 3-6 weeks is advised.
Ulcer/wound management: One session every 2 weeks till complete healing.
Facial rejuvenation/scar management/stretch marks: 6 sessions done once every 4 weeks.

The procedure is completely safe since it’s your own blood that is drawn, processed and injected under completely sterile conditions.

Before and after undergoing the treatment, you need to keep in mind the following instructions to ensure optimal results

  • Wash scalp on the day of the procedure.
  • Avoid application of any product (hair spray/gel/wax) before the procedure.
  • Patients can immediately resume back to their work post procedure.
  • Do not wash your hair 24 hours after the PRP therapy is done.
  • Patients can wash hair with regular shampoo after one day of treatment.
